1

Not known Factual Statements About cat toys

News Discuss 
Petholicks is known as a energetic pet shop in Dubai that provides a big range of services and products for just a myriad of pet business people. Our comprehensive-products and services Veterinarian Hospitals supply in depth care – from system examinations to crisis surgical strategies. You could possibly rely on https://judyg849wur2.blogginaway.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story